Abstract:
Various aspects of the present disclosure generally relate to wireless communication. In some aspects, a user equipment may receive a radio resource control (RRC) resume message, associated with transitioning the UE from an inactive state to a connected state. The UE may configure, based at least in part on receiving the RRC resume message, the UE with a serving cell common configuration, associated with a serving cell of the UE, received in a system information block (SIB) associated with the serving cell. Numerous other aspects are provided.
Abstract:
Methods and apparatus are described for cell reselection when camping on a small cell. The methods and apparatus include determining, by a user equipment (UE), whether to perform a cell reselection evaluation after camping on a small cell communicating with the UE; performing a measurement of a signal transmitted by the small cell in response to determining whether to perform the cell reselection evaluation; determining that a signal characteristic based on the measurement of the signal of the small cell falls below a cell reselection measurement triggering threshold; performing a measurement of a respective signal transmitted by one or more other cells in only a serving frequency; ranking the small cell relative to the one or more other cells; and remaining camped on the small cell when the small cell is ranked higher than the one or more other cells.
Abstract:
Methods and apparatus for wireless communication for improving back to back cell reselection that includes establishing that cell reselection to a primary candidate cell has failed. Afterwards, a UE determines if a set of predetermined conditions have been triggered and schedules cell reselection to a secondary candidate based on whether the set of predetermined conditions have been triggered.
